Totiž... jak to... po dvou letech v PHP jsem se smysluplně programovat spíš odnaučil. PHP je skriptovací jazyk a jisté věci v něm jsou tak špatně dělané, že přináší spíš zlozvyky. Vzpomenul bych například objekty nebo přetypování.
Ten "type-hinting" Vám může pěkně zavařit, ale to už po dvou letech programování v PHP nejspíš víte. Navíc, mezi PHP4 a PHP5 jsou takové rozdíly, že existuje kód, který vrací jiné výsledky v PHP4 a v PHP5, což je úplná katastrofa. Takže myslet si, že po dvou letech s PHP lze přejít intuitivně na Javu je přinejmenším odvážné. Upřímně, z Vašich otázek vyplývá buď to, že nevíte na co se zeptat (věc, která každého odradí aby Vám odpověděl), nebo že se ptáte na úplně začátečnické věci (věc, která každého odradí aby Vám odpověděl). Já s Javou rovněž teprve začínám, ale věci, na které se ptáte už vím z webů, samostudia nebo z metody pokus - omyl. Jestliže komunita získá pocit, že tu spamujete, asi Vám fakt přestanou odpovídat, takže další dotazy zvažte, než je položíte. Jinak, zrovna tady v konferenci je pár lidí, které stojí za to respektovat. Například jsou tu občas k vidění autoři knih, které Vám doporučujeme přečíst ;-)) Petr Zajíc -----Original Message----- From: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ED] Behalf Of Kamzik-II Sent: Saturday, July 29, 2006 2:29 PM To: Java Subject: Re: Validace Jj slo o tridu spirng.util.Assert, prominte za nepresnost, no ale ja jsem ji nechtel pouzit, jenom jsem byl zmaten tim ze dela to same co moje trida, akorat ze se menuje assert o nic vic mi neslo. No ja se programovat neucim jeden den ;-) Nejsem zadny profesional, ale 2roky v php uz mam za sebou, zacinal jsem v delphi, nejake zaklady tudiz mam ;-) V php funguje type-hinting trochu jinak, neni tam povolena nulova instance, takze kdyz napisu ze ocekavam jako argument objekt, tak dostanu objekt, vim v jave to funguje trochu jinak, ale prijde mi divne, ze by se s tim nikdo nezajimal, treba to reseni pomoci anotaci by mozna bylo fajn, ale muselo by byt asi primo na urovni jazyka. No nic asi to udelam pres copy&paste metodu :-/
